Output eef8fc46eaa6791a6c00541e399b375fbe45ab0e1a06c0d5f51083fc4cf0f295:63

value
68229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9bbf764d153e161eaba2d8fa42b5d839690c85 OP_EQUAL
address
3JhiBn5FEL7kpJFeWFLrLVhguz6zk7BSwC
transaction
eef8fc46eaa6791a6c00541e399b375fbe45ab0e1a06c0d5f51083fc4cf0f295
spent
true